We Can Do Hard Things
I wanted to start the year out with an encouraging charge to my students. "We can do hard things" seemed appropriate since last year I heard a lot of "I can't do that, it's too hard" "I'm not good at that" & "I don't know how". We first talked about a quote from Vincent Van Gogh, "If you hear a voice within you say 'you cannot paint,' then by all means paint, and that voice will be silenced." They had a lot of good things to say about this when I asked them what it meant to them. The 4th & 5th graders talked together in their groups and came to a group decision before sharing with the class (got that higher level of thinking). Then I gave instructions on how we would make a motivational poster so that they would remember this year's motto.
